Tenant Demand Remains Strong
Demand for rental properties continues across most northern suburbs, particularly in areas offering convenient access to schools, public transport, shopping centres and employment hubs.
Family homes remain highly sought after, particularly those offering modern kitchens, multiple living areas, air-conditioning and low-maintenance outdoor spaces.
Properties close to train stations, major road networks and coastal amenities are also attracting significant interest from prospective tenants.
What Types of Tenants Are Applying?
One of the most noticeable trends within the Joondalup to Yanchep rental market is the diversity of tenants currently applying for rental properties.
Current applications regularly include:
- Professional couples
- Growing families
- FIFO workers
- Healthcare professionals
- Defence personnel
- Interstate relocations
- Local residents upgrading or relocating within the northern suburbs
This broad tenant pool continues to support strong demand across a range of property types.
Joondalup Rental Market
Joondalup remains one of Perth’s most popular rental locations.
The combination of Edith Cowan University, Joondalup Health Campus, Lakeside Joondalup Shopping Centre and excellent transport links continues to attract a wide range of tenants.
Apartments, townhouses and family homes all perform well, particularly those located close to the city center and train station precinct.
Butler, Alkimos and Yanchep Rental Market
Further north, demand remains strong as more tenants seek newer homes, larger blocks and value for money.
The continued growth of Butler, Alkimos and Yanchep, combined with improving infrastructure and transport connections, is attracting both families and professionals looking for lifestyle and affordability.
Modern homes with practical floorplans, air conditioning and low-maintenance gardens continue to attract strong enquiry.
Presentation Matters More Than Ever
Although tenant demand remains healthy, applicants are becoming increasingly selective.
Today’s tenants are comparing multiple properties before making a decision and are paying close attention to presentation, cleanliness, maintenance, security and overall value.
For landlords, this means that pricing and presentation remain critical to achieving the best possible leasing outcome.
